In this video we look at how people from South Asian communities are much more likely to be diagnosed with diabetes, what that means for our long-term health and the symptoms of long-term complications that we need to look out for.

Understanding the community support around diagnosis, and how our community can support one another.

It’s important to get health information in a language we can understand. We shouldn’t have to struggle, and we can ask for support. Your healthcare team can help translate questions or information into native languages.
